Kurt Zouma's weakness, Reece James' big asset and surprise stat after Chelsea draw with Sevilla

Perhaps the sense of panic was exacerbated by the defender next to him exuding such calm but the Frenchman looked like the weak link in an otherwise much improved backline.

There was an awful attempted clearance on the verge of half-time, he had another scare when he took a poor first touch when dealing with a long ball midway through the second half and was bailed out once more when pressed into another error entering the final 15 minutes.

In the air Zouma is Chelsea's best defender but opponents have earmarked something they can exploit: press him fast and he can cough up an error.

Reece James deliveries

The highlight of a tepid game from a Chelsea point of view - aside from keeping a convcincing clean sheet - was Reece James's deliveries. The right back, chosen ahead of Cesar Azpilicueta for his attacking ability, provided a series of good balls that deserved to be finished and it is unquestionably his best asset.

Havertz needs more time

The German looked subdued again last night, unable to get his creative juices flowing against a well-organised team. An adaptation period is clearly needed but the £72million transfer fee means he will be under pressure quickly. Expectations are high and right now, at this early stage, he is not meeting them. It is worth remembering that he started last season at Bayer Leverkusen slowly too.

Captain conundrum

Cesar Azpilicueta's absence meant that Jorginho wore the captain's armband until he was substituted in the 65th minute for Mateo Kovacic. He initially looked unsure who to hand it to before making his way off but gave it to N'Golo Kante.

Now the interesting tidbit here is that Thiago Silva was captain in his first start against West Bromwich Albion last month when Kante was on the field. Lampard spoke about the Brazilian's leadership qualities from the outset but then there were questions over his ability to speak English.

A surprise statistic

This was the first scoreless draw of Lampard's reign - 63 games.

There are still questions over finding the right balance but after Saturday's defensive problems, a clean sheet against quality opposition was a big boost.
